免费试用

中文化、本土化、云端化的在线跨平台软件开发工具,支持APP、电脑端、小程序、IOS免签等等

安卓改签名软件

安卓改签名是指在Android应用程序的数字签名信息中进行修改或替换。数字签名是用于验证应用程序来源和完整性的重要组成部分。在正常情况下,应用程序的数字签名会由开发者用其私钥生成,并与应用程序一起发布到应用商店或其他渠道。这样,用户在安装应用程序时就可以验证应用程序的来源和完整性,确保应用程序没有被篡改过。

然而,某些情况下,我们可能需要改变应用程序的签名信息。例如,当我们想对一个已经存在的应用程序进行修改时,为了使修改后的应用程序能够安装在与原应用程序不冲突的设备上,我们需要改变其签名信息。此外,有时候我们也需要伪造一个应用程序的签名,以绕过对签名的校验。

下面将介绍两种常用的安卓改签名方法。

1. 使用Android Studio

Android Studio是一种流行的开发工具,几乎每个安卓开发者都在使用。利用Android Studio可以相对容易地改变应用程序的签名信息。

首先,打开Android Studio并导入你要修改签名的应用程序项目。然后,点击顶部菜单栏的"Build",再选择"Generate Signed Bundle / APK"。在弹出的窗口中,选择"APK"并点击"Next"。

接下来,你需要创建或导入一个新的密钥库文件。密钥库文件是存储你的私钥和证书的文件,可以用于生成签名信息。在创建或导入密钥库文件后,填写必要的信息,如密钥库密码、别名和密码等。

完成上述步骤后,你将会看到一个界面,可以选择你要修改签名的应用程序的路径。此时,你可以选择你的应用程序的存储路径,或者选择已经打包好的应用程序(.apk文件)。

最后,点击"Finish"按钮开始生成新的签名应用程序。Android Studio将会使用你提供的新的签名信息来重新签名应用程序,并生成新的.apk文件。

2. 使用第三方工具

除了Android Studio,还有一些第三方工具也可以帮助我们改变应用程序的签名信息。

例如,ApkTool是一款非常流行的反编译和回编译工具,它可以用于修改已有应用程序的签名信息。首先,你需要下载并安装ApkTool。然后使用ApkTool反编译你要修改签名的应用程序。

在反编译的过程中,ApkTool会将应用程序的源码、资源文件和AndroidManifest.xml等文件提取出来。你可以通过修改AndroidManifest.xml文件中的签名信息来改变应用程序的签名。

修改完签名信息后,使用ApkTool回编译应用程序。回编译的过程会将修改过的文件重新打包成应用程序。最后,你可以使用其他工具来签名你的应用程序,或者直接将应用程序安装到设备上。

总结起来,改变应用程序的签名信息是一个相对复杂的过程,需要一定的技术知识和经验。不正确的操作可能会导致应用程序无法正常工作或在某些情况下被拒绝。因此,在进行应用程序签名的修改时,务必谨慎,并在了解相关知识的前提下进行操作。


相关知识:
苹果超级签名安装吗
苹果超级签名是一种用于绕过苹果iOS设备限制的方法,它允许用户安装未经官方认证的应用程序。在正常情况下,iOS设备只允许安装来自App Store的应用程序,这限制了用户的选择和自由。而使用超级签名,用户可以安装来自第三方的应用程序,包括一些不在App S
2023-07-20
ipa文件用什么签名
在iOS开发中,签名是指给ipa文件添加数字签名,以验证应用程序的身份和完整性。在App Store发布应用之前,必须对应用进行签名。签名使用的证书是由Apple颁发的开发者证书或者发布证书。签名的过程如下:1. 首先,开发者需要生成一个证书签名请求(Ce
2023-07-18
ipa udid 签名
UDID是iOS设备的唯一标识符,全称为Unique Device Identifier,用于标识每台iOS设备的唯一性。在过去的几年里,UDID被广泛用于移动广告追踪、应用测试和开发等领域。然而,由于隐私和安全方面的考虑,苹果公司从iOS 5开始,禁止开
2023-07-18
安卓手机签名异常怎么改
安卓手机签名异常是指在安装应用程序时,系统返回“签名验证失败”或类似的错误提示。通常情况下,安卓系统会对应用程序的数字签名进行验证,以确保应用程序的完整性和安全性。如果签名验证失败,可能是应用程序被篡改或签名证书过期等原因导致。本文将为您详细介绍安卓手机签
2023-07-17
安卓13签名校验
安卓13签名校验(Android 13 Signature Verification)是安卓系统在Android 11版本之后引入的一种新的签名校验机制,旨在提升应用程序的安全性。在Android安装应用时,系统将会验证应用的数字签名信息,以确保应用的完整
2023-07-17
android配置https证书
在Android开发中,配置HTTPS证书是保证应用与服务器之间安全通信的重要环节。HTTPS是一种基于TLS/SSL协议的加密传输协议,通过使用HTTPS可以防止信息被窃听、篡改或伪装等安全问题。HTTPS证书的配置包含两个方面:服务器端配置和客户端配置
2023-07-17
©2015-2021 成都七扇门科技有限公司 yimenapp.com  川公网安备 51019002001185号 蜀ICP备17005078号-4